Evaluate the following.
`int "x"^3/sqrt(1 + "x"^4)` dx

उत्तर
Let I = `int x^3/sqrt(1 + x^4)` dx
Put 1 + x4 = t
∴ 4x3 . dx = dt
∴ x3 . dx = `1/4` dt
∴ I = `1/4 int dt/sqrtt`
`= 1/4 int t^((-1)/2)`dt
`= 1/4 * t^(1/2)/(1/2)` + c
`= 1/2 sqrtt + c`
∴ I = `1/2 sqrt(1 + x^4)` + c
